Output 26b9b973133e809ac9775476bba9a592a67d566dce1845605a9bbf287e92c253:7

value
41486304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17896614692943fa15cd88fa426b77e7b83ce05d OP_EQUAL
address
MA3cNUVEnYMraHBRRH6GJb7XXRp9kgs4Lj
transaction
26b9b973133e809ac9775476bba9a592a67d566dce1845605a9bbf287e92c253
spent
true